For over fifty years, Georg Kuhlewind has worked to develop a universal cognitive spiritual path. Soundly based in contemporary consciousness, his writings on meditation are among the clearest available today. This book consists of three parts. The first is a short, practical treatise on meditation in the form of a sequence of exercises. An extended essay on "the soft will" follows. (The soft will--which is the will that works in speaking, as well as in artistic activities like playing the piano--is the will we use in meditation.) In the last part, we are led on a meditative journey though selected passages drawn from Zen Buddhism, Thomas Aquinas and the great early twentieth-century spiritual master and founder of anthroposophy, Rudolf Steiner.
